M.S. Ramachandra Rao, J.
1. This Civil Revision Petition is filed challenging the order dt. 19-08-2014 in I.A. No. 753 of 2012 in O.S. No. 104 of 2012 of the I Additional Junior Civil Judge, Tirupati. The petitioners herein are defendants in the suit.
2. The respondents/plaintiffs filed the suit for a perpetual injunction restraining the petitioners from interfering with their alleged peaceful possession and enjoyment of the plaint schedule properties. In the plaint, it is alleged by respondents that petitioners created certain documents in order to encroach on the southern side of the plaint schedule properties and they also attempted to close a channel by encroaching into the lands of respondents on the southern side of the plaint schedule properties.
3. Written statement was filed by 4th defendant/4th petitioner claiming that they have jointly purchased the lands adjacent to the plaint schedule properties and that the plaint schedule properties are to the north of the land of 4th petitioner and he had no necessity to interfere with the lands of respondents.
